Condence intervals
The condence interval calculations that the HP Prime can perform are based on the Normal Z-distribution or
Student’s t-distribution.
One-Sample Z-Interval
Menu name
Z-Int: 1 μ
This option uses the Normal Z-distribution to calculate a condence interval for μ, the true mean of a
population, when the true population standard deviation, σ, is known.
Inputs
The inputs are as follows:
Field name Description
ẋ Sample mean
n Sample size
σ Population standard deviation
C Condence level
